Challenge 1 - Task 1
Integrate TLS Certificate Issued by the OCI Certificates Service with Load Balancer
You are a cloud engineer at a tech company that is migrating its services to Oracle Cloud Infrastructure (OCI). You are required to set up secure communication for your web application using OCI's Certificate service. You need to create a Certificate Authority (CA), issue a TLS/SSL server certificate, and configure a load balancer to use this certificate to ensure encrypted traffic between clients and the backend servers.
Review the architecture diagram, which outlines the resources you'll need to address the requirement.
Preconfigured
To complete this requirement, you are provided with the following:
Access to an OCI tenancy, an assigned compartment, and OCI credentials
Required IAM policies
OCI Vault to store the secret required by the program, which is created in the root compartment as PBI_Vault_SP
Task 1: Create and Configure a Virtual Cloud Network (VCN)
Create a Virtual Cloud Network (VCN) namedPBT-CERT-VCN-01with the following specifications:
VCN with a CIDR block of 10.0.0.0/16
Subnet 1 (Compute Instance):
Name:Compute-Subnet-PBT-CERT
CIDR Block:10.0.1.0/24
Subnet 2 (Load Balancer):
Name:LB-Subnet-PBT-CERT-SNET-02
CIDR Block:10.0.2.0/24
Internet Gatewayfor external connectivity
Route table and security lists:
Security List namedPBT-CERT-CS-SL-01for Subnet 1 (Compute-Subnet-PBT-CERT) to allow SSH (port 22) traffic
Security List namedPBT-CERT-LB-SL-01for Subnet 2 (LB-Subnet-PBT-CERT) to allow HTTPS (port 443) traffic
